Sealion's New SPSV Thrusts Ahead
01 Jul 2003
Appledore Shipbuilders chose ASI Robicon to provide the propulsion and thruster system for the newbuild 83m shallow draught platform supply vessel (SPSV) being built for Sealion Shipping under Lloyds Register classification. The diesel electric vessel is propelled by two aft main Kamewa fixed pitch thrusters and two bow fixed pitch tunnel thrusters for manoeuvring.
In order to minimise the need for ventilation and bulky ductwork, ASIRobicon provided totally enclosed fresh water cooled drive equipment throughout.
The 2,200kW 0/1,200rpm IP44 cage induction main thruster motors are each controlled by ASIRobicon UK 'Aquamarine' water cooled drives with 24 pulse special ASIRobicon design phase shift water cooled transformers.
Aquamarine 12 pulse drives are used to control the 735kW 0/1,200rpm tunnel thruster vertical water cooled motors.
Major features of the drive systems are compactness, low noise and expected low harmonic distortion of the 690V and ship service supplies.
